Solve graphically
y = 2x + 1, y + 3x – 6 = 0
Advertisements
उत्तर
y = 2x + 1
| x | – 3 | – 1 | 0 | 2 |
| y | – 5 | – 1 | 1 | 5 |
Plot the points (– 3, – 5), (– 1, – 1), (0, 1) and (2, 5) in the graph sheet
y + 3x – 6 = 0
y = – 3x + 6
| x | – 2 | – 1 | 0 | 2 |
| y | 12 | 9 | 6 | 0 |
Plot the points (– 2, 12), (– 1, 9), (0, 6) and (2, 0) in the same graph sheet
The two lines l1 and l2 intersect at (1, 3).
∴ The solution set is (1, 3).
